Overview
Great Year Cycle
The Great Year is not one single ancient idea with one fixed length. In Greek and later traditions, it often means a grand cycle in which celestial bodies return to their starting arrangement. Plato described a “perfect year” in the *Timaeus*, but there is no strong evidence that Plato meant the precession of the equinoxes. Later authors, astrologers, and modern writers used “Great Year” in different ways. In modern popular usage, the Great Year is often equated with the precessional cycle of roughly 25,700 to 26,000 years. This is useful in astronomy education and astrology, but it can distort older sources. A Platonic planetary cycle, a precessional cycle, a zodiac-age cycle, and a mythic world-age cycle are related by theme, not automatically identical.

Plain-language explanation
A normal year is the time it takes the Sun to return through the seasons. A Great Year is a much larger imagined or calculated cycle. In some versions, it is the time needed for the planets and fixed stars to return to their original arrangement. In other versions, it is the full precession cycle. In astrology, it may be divided into zodiac ages. In myth, it can become a cycle of creation, decline, destruction, and renewal. The confusion begins because all these ideas are about return, repetition, and cosmic order. But similarity of theme does not mean the same technical concept. Plato's perfect year is not automatically the precession of the equinoxes. Later writers used different numbers. Modern authors often fuse the Platonic, astrological, and precessional meanings into one simplified story.
Historical and scholarly context
Plato's perfect year
Plato's “perfect year” should be read in its philosophical and cosmological context. It is about celestial order and the return of the motions of the heavens. It is not direct evidence that Plato knew precession. Since Hipparchus is credited with discovering precession roughly two centuries later, claims that Plato meant the precessional cycle need extra support.
Later Great Year values
Ancient authors did not agree on one Great Year length. Cicero, Macrobius, Censorinus, and later interpreters preserve differing cycle lengths and meanings. This variation matters. If a source gives a different length from the precessional cycle, it should not be forced into a 26,000-year model.
Modern precessional Great Year
Modern astronomy and astrology often use Great Year to mean the full precessional cycle. This is a valid modern convention if clearly labeled. The problem is when it is projected backward as if every ancient Great Year reference meant the same thing.
What the evidence supports
The strongest support is textual: Plato, Cicero, and later authors clearly discuss large celestial cycles. The modern astronomical cycle of precession is also real. The Great Year therefore has both textual and astronomical anchors.
The weak point is identity. Not every large cycle is the same cycle. The Great Year is best treated as a family of related concepts rather than one unchanging doctrine.
Limits and disputed claims
- Treating Plato's perfect year as definitely precession is disputed.
- Treating all Great Year numbers as corrupt versions of 25,920 is speculative.
- Treating zodiac ages as precise historical eras is weak.
- Treating Great Year cycles as catastrophe clocks lacks evidence.
- Treating cross-cultural world ages as proof of a single source usually lacks transmission evidence.
